However, as beautiful as this winter storm may be, it is important to take necessary precautions and stay safe. The National Weather Service advises people to avoid traveling during this time, as roads and highways may be dangerous due to heavy snow and strong winds. If you do plan to venture out, make sure to check road conditions and have proper winter gear and supplies.
